Data validation ensures that the data is correct and reliable.

This is critical because decisions based on bad data can be costly. Data control prevents errors from entering the data system. It saves time and ensures that other processes that use this data are not ruined.

Let's consider the example of an e-commerce store.

When customers place an order, they provide information such as their name, address, and payment details. If this data is not validated, incorrect information could lead to failed transactions, delivery to the wrong address, or even security issues.

Therefore, data validation is essential to ensure the smooth running of the store and customer satisfaction.
